Abstract
The food packing composite film includes at least one printed plastic film layer, one aluminum plated heat sealing layer and one adhesive layer to adhere the printed plastic film layer and the aluminum plated heat sealing layer into one integral structure. The adhesive layer may be of common glue or special glue for aluminum plated layer, and the compounding mode may be a dry one, a wet one or no-solvent one. The composite film product has ply separation resistance not lower than 0.8 N/ sq m and heat sealing strength not lower than 1 N/sq m, and is cut and further made into required packing bag. The present invention has the advantages of certain metal texture, certain transparent degree for showing packed matter and excellent obstructing function to oxygen and water vapor.
Description
Technical field
The present invention relates to a kind of food packing composite film, the invention still further relates to the manufacture method of this food packing composite film.
Background technology
Food in the market, use the comparatively of composite film packaging to see more, except aluminium foil layer is arranged, the complex film of paper layer, remaining can be divided into non-aluminized complex film and aluminized complex film, non-aluminized complex film has certain bandwagon effect to content, aluminized complex film then is to adopt metallized film at interlayer or internal layer, improved the metal-like of whole packing, but the packing material bandwagon effect that does not possess non-aluminized complex film, to the barriering effect of oxygen and water vapour is that with the non-aluminizer of spline structure tens times are to hundreds of times, for some instant packagings for foodstuff, its barriering effect does not find full expression, be actually a kind of waste, promptly excessive packaging causes the waste of cost and resource, increases difficulty for simultaneously raw-material recycling.For common aluminized products, its compound tense generally must adopt specific glue special, and price is higher.
Summary of the invention
The object of the present invention is to provide a kind of with low costly, have the food packing composite film of certain presentation effect and metal-like.The present invention also provides the manufacture method of this food packing composite film simultaneously.
For achieving the above object, the present invention can take following technical proposals:
Food packing composite film of the present invention comprises the complex film body, it is characterized in that: described complex film body comprises at least one plastics undertake the printing of layer, adhesive layer and the hot sealing layer of aluminizing.
Described plastics undertake the printing of the layer and aluminize hot sealing layer bonding by adhesive layer be an integral structure.
Described plastics are undertaken the printing of layer for having the plastic layer of good transparency.
The described hot sealing layer of aluminizing is to have the necessarily heat sealable polyethylene or the cast polypropylene film of the amount of aluminizing, and its optical density (OD) is between 0.2--0.8.
The described plastics layer thickness of undertaking the printing of is 8--100 μ m, and the thickness of the described hot sealing layer of aluminizing is 15--80 μ m.
Described adhesive layer is the common glue layer or the special glue water layer of aluminizing.
The manufacture method of food packing composite film of the present invention is: is integral structure with undertake the printing of layer and the hot sealing layer of aluminizing of the plastics that print by the compound slaking of adhesive layer, wherein adhesion agent can adopt the common glue or the glue special of aluminizing, complex method comprises dry type, wet type, solvent-free complex method, forms interlaminar strength 〉=0.8N/m after compound slaking
2, heat seal strength 〉=1N/m
2The complex film finished product, through cut, bag makes needed packaging film and gets final product.
The invention has the advantages that and adopt special straticulate structure and the material of this kind, simplified the aluminum plating process process of the hot sealing layer of aluminizing, compound tense is not limited to adopt the glue special of aluminizing, and can adopt multiple complex method simultaneously, and therefore the food package film of making is with low cost.After compound slaking moulding, the finished product complex film had both had metal-like, had certain perspectivity again, had satisfied to the display function of packing material with to the barriers function of oxygen and water vapour.The packaging film that the present invention in addition protected is convenient the recovery after use, is beneficial to environmental protection, for instant noodles, biscuit etc. fast the packing of consumer food a kind of new method is provided.

The specific embodiment
Embodiment 1:
As shown in the figure, a kind of food packing composite film comprises plastics undertake the printing of layer 1, adhesive layer 2 and the hot sealing layer 3 of aluminizing, and plastics are undertaken the printing of layer 1 and the hot sealing layer 3 of aluminizing by adhesive phase 2 be combined into one (aluminize face and plastics undertake the printing of layer compound); Plastics are undertaken the printing of layer for BOPP (Biaxially oriented polypropylene), thickness is 20 μ m, mode of printing is the lining seal, the hot sealing layer of aluminizing adopts the aluminize CPP of optical density (OD) between 0.38--0.50, thickness is 45 μ m, the employing dry type is compound, and packaging film presents the certain metal-like and the transparency after the slaking, forms interlaminar strength 〉=0.8N/m
2, heat seal strength 〉=1N/m
2The complex film finished product, cut into needed packaging film through branch.
Embodiment 2:
As shown in the figure, a kind of food packing composite film comprises plastics undertake the printing of layer 1, adhesive layer 2 and the hot sealing layer 3 of aluminizing, and plastics are undertaken the printing of layer 1 and the hot sealing layer 3 of aluminizing by adhesive phase 2 be combined into one (aluminize face and plastics undertake the printing of layer compound); Plastics are undertaken the printing of layer for BOPP (Biaxially oriented polypropylene), and thickness is 18 μ m, and the thickness of the CPP that aluminizes is 30 μ m, optical density (OD) is between 0.12--0.26, the employing dry type is compound, and packaging film presents the certain metal-like and the transparency after the slaking, forms interlaminar strength 〉=0.8N/m
2, heat seal strength 〉=1N/m
2The complex film finished product, cut into needed packaging film through branch.
